Patient data held by hacker group after cyber attack, health board confirms

Hacker group INC Ransom has claimed it holds three terabytes of confidential data from NHS Scotland. The group posted a sample of genuine data on its dark web blog. The NHS said the attack was contained to a single health board. Jeff Ace, the board’s chief executive, condemned the hackers and said police and cyber security agencies were investigating the incident, and patients whose data had been published would be informed.
